在活动中创建自定义侦听器,然后从另一个活动中调用它

时间:2019-03-14 21:48:58

标签: java android

我在活动内而不是在Java类内声明自定义侦听器时遇到问题。问题是如何创建,触发然后实现它。想法如下: 我的活动详细信息将附加到名为下载的侦听器中。当用户下载书籍时,将触发侦听器,然后将其添加到另一个活动中的数组适配器,例如DownloadedBooksActivity。

1 个答案:

答案 0 :(得分:0)

为此,您可以将DownloadedBooksActivity的数据存储在数据库中,然后观察其中的变化。 下载完成后,立即更新数据库中的已下载项目,然后DownloadedBooksActivity将自动侦听更改。 为此,您可以使用RoomObjectBox